Detecting AI-generated content can be challenging, but there are a few signs to look out for that can help you determine if something was likely created by a machine:
1. Lack of human error: AI-generated content is typically free from spelling mistakes, grammatical errors, or inconsistencies in style and tone that are common in content created by humans.
2. Unnatural language patterns: AI-generated content may have unnatural language patterns, phrases, or word choices that don’t quite sound like genuine human speech.
3. Lack of personalization: AI-generated content may lack personal touches or individual nuances that often come from human creators.
4. Repetitive content: AI-generated content may rely on the same phrases, structures, or ideas being repeated multiple times throughout the piece.
5. Unusual sources or topics: Content that seems to cover a wide range of topics or sources in a short amount of time may be a sign of AI-generated content pulling information from a large database.
6. Rapid production: AI-generated content can be produced at a much faster pace than human-created content, so if you see a large volume of content appearing suddenly, it could be a sign that AI is involved.
It’s important to note that AI technology is constantly evolving, and some AI-generated content may be difficult to differentiate from human-created content. However, by keeping an eye out for these signs, you can become more adept at detecting AI-generated content.
